Privacy Act of 1974: System of Records

AGENCY:

Department of Commerce.

ACTION:

Notice of Amendment of Privacy Act System of Records: COMMERCE/DEPARTMENT-18, Employees Personnel Files Not Covered by Notices of Other Agencies.

SUMMARY:

In accordance with the Privacy Act of 1974, as amended, 5 U.S.C.552a(e)(4) and (11), the Department of Commerce is issuing notice of intent to amend the system of records under COMMERCE/DEPARTMENT-18, Employees Personnel Files Not Covered by Notices of Other Agencies. This amendment adds to this system those records compiled in conjunction with the Department of Commerce's Drug and Alcohol-Free Workplace Program. We invite public comment on the proposed changes in this publication.

SUPPLEMENTARY INFORMATION:

This amendment adds to the referenced system those files containing records compiled in accordance with the Drug and Alcohol-Free Workplace Program under the requirements of Executive Order 12564: Public Law 100-71, dated July 11, 1987.

Routine uses of records maintained in the system, including categories of users and the purposes of such uses:

After "(15) A record in this system of records may be disclosed to Senior State Department officials at U.S. Embassies, including the Ambassador, Deputy Chief of Mission, Administrative Counselor and Human Resource Officers, for matters relating to employment or security issues pertaining to Department of Commerce employees working in U.S. Embassies or facilities overseas." add "(16) A record in this system of records may be disclosed to the U.S. Coast Guard for National Oceanic and Atmospheric Administration wage marine employees for the purpose of complying with the requirements of the Drug and Alcohol-Free Workplace Program. (17) A record in this system of records may be disclosed to the U.S. Department of Transportation for employees in transportation positions for the purpose of complying with the requirements of the Omnibus Transportation Employee Testing Act of 1991 and 49 CFR Part 40."
